Abstract
The regression correlative analysis of the aqueous-organic solvents' (water-methanol, water-ethanol and water-propan-2-ol) effect on the strength of amino acids (α-alanine, valine) has been provided at 298.15 K. Energetic contributions of acceptor ÎÎGd,10(ETN) and cohesion ÎÎGd,10(δN2) properties of water-organic solvents into amino acid strength with carboxylic groups change ÎÎGd,10, and energetic contributions of acceptor ÎÎGd,20(ETN), cohesion ÎÎGd,20(δN2) and dielectric ÎÎGd,20(εNâ 1) properties of water-organic solvents into amino acid strength with amino groups change ÎÎGd,20 are evaluated.
